## Releases

Cutting a ChipHare release is pretty painless. Tag the commit, let CI build the reader firmware and the gateway binary, then sign both before the timing-chip fleet will accept them. Don't hand-edit the manifest — the verifier is picky. Reviewers: check that the release branch matches the tag before approving. Signing happens locally with the key shown below.

signing key of bagap-yawep = bky13_TbfT6ZMUoGJo2

QUARTERLY PLANNING NOTE — For the incoming director

Discount policy, large deals: standing floor is 18% off list for orders above 500 units of the Veltrin series. Anything deeper requires finance sign-off from Okafor and a two-year commitment. Exceptions granted last quarter (Marbury, Dellhaven accounts) expire at renewal. Sales comp now accrues on net, not gross. Policy context reflects the direction noted below.

board note of fahag-tajop: The eastern region missed its Julix quota by 44.0 percent last quarter. Ralionax Holdings plans to lower the Druath list price by 61.8 percent in March. The board signed off on a budget of $295.0 million for Project Gilath. The renewal with Ruswynix Systems closes at $274.5 million a year, 17.0 percent above the last contract.

## Service account: canary-gate

The `canary-gate` account enforces Driftbay's promotion rules: canaries must hold 5% traffic for 30 minutes with error rate under 0.5% before full rollout. On-call may force-promote or roll back via the gating API; both actions are audited. Do not disable gating on weekends. Authenticate gating calls with the account key below.

gateway credential: kto3_qfe